Set out on a journey through quintessential Dutch landscapes to Zaanse Schans and Volendam, each offering a unique charm. The day begins in idyllic Zaanse Schans, a historic windmill village brimming with old-world charm. Step back in time to the area's industrial heyday, when approximately 700 windmills dotted the landscape (now, only five remain). This picturesque hamlet provides an authentic glimpse into seventeenth and eighteenth century life in a typical Zaanse village. After soaking up the village's charm, sit back and relax as you next venture to the charming fishing village of Volendam. Nestled in the Dutch countryside, you'll be treated to views of polders and peaceful canals en-route to the village. Wander through time as you encounter historic houses, classic fishing boats, and local residents who still embrace traditional attire in their daily lives. Indulge in a truly exclusive experience as you meet your private guide at a charming cafÉ located only steps away from the world-renowned Louvre Museum. The Louvre boasts an unparalleled art collection ranging from Ancient Greece to the 19th century. Accompanied by your private guide, behold the masterpieces that have left their indelible mark on art history, including the enigmatic Mona Lisa by Da Vinci, the remarkable Winged Victory of Samothrace, and the Venus de Milo, both over two millennia old and hailing from ancient Greece. See the impressive Great Sphinx of Tanis, which dates back 4,600 years and remains a relic of the Egyptians. Admire Eugene Delacroix's iconic Liberty Leading the People, which glorifies the people's victory in the French Revolution. Be sure to take a closer look at the Code of Hammurabi, a black basalt tablet shaped like an index finger, bearing a code just under 4,000 years old. Unravel the fascinating stories behind each of these timeless works and delve deep into the remarkable history of the Louvre. Meet your private guide and set out on foot along the banks of the historic Seine River on a journey through the evolution of Paris. Throughout, your guide points out several fascinating sites on your riverside journey according to your interests. Start at the medieval Ile de la Cite, the birthplace of Paris and home to the stunning Saint Chapelle chapel and Notre Dame cathedral - one of the most famous Catholic churches in the world. Cross the striking Pont Neuf, considered the oldest standing bridge in the city, and make your way to the courtyards of the world-famous Louvre, housed within the largest palace in Europe. Wander through the beautiful Tuileries Gardens, on your way to the MusÉe de l'Orangerie, an impressive neoclassical building built by Napolean III, and home to Monet's celebrated Water Lilies series. Admire the ancient Luxor Obelisk as you pass through the Place de Concorde, Paris' largest public square. Cross over the ornate Pont Alexandre III, keeping an eye out for its extravagant golden statues, as you make your way to the stately Invalides, where lies the impressive Military Museum as well as The Tomb of Napoleon. Conclude your journey at the iconic Eiffel Tower, for a ground-level photo opportunity of this must-see monument. Meet your private guide, departing London for a half-day tour to Windsor, where you'll visit the royal residence of Windsor Castle, the oldest and largest occupied castle in the world, and the Official Residence of King Charles III. Dating back to the 11th century, Windsor Castle's dramatic site encapsulates nearly 1,000 years of British history, having been the home of 39 monarchs. The Castle covers an area of about 13 acres, and highlights of your visit include the magnificent State Apartments, furnished with treasures from the Royal Collection, including paintings by Rembrandt, Rubens, Canaletto, and Gainsborough. Admire the Semi-State Rooms (private apartments created for George IV), as well as St George's Chapel, one of the finest examples of Gothic architecture in England, and the burial place of 10 monarchs. Tying everything together is an expanse of finely manicured grounds. While here, there's never any doubt you're in the company of royalty. Conclude your day on your return to London.
Skip the largest part of the queue today at The London Eye with your exclusive Fast Track admission, and take to the skies for a unique perspective over the city of London below. At a height of 443 feet, The London Eye is the largest cantilevered observation wheel in Europe, and receives over three million visitors each year. Your near 30-minute ride will complete after one full rotation of the wheel, allowing for a pleasurable pace as you ascend and descend, with plenty of opportunity to spot several iconic landmarks from an elevated vantage point on the south bank of the River Thames.
